RNA Polymerases

Enzymes that are responsible for transcribing RNA from a DNA template, playing a key role in the process of gene expression.

Transcription

The process by which the genetic information in DNA is copied into messenger RNA (mRNA) for protein synthesis.

tRNA Triplet

A sequence of three nucleotides in transfer RNA that is complementary to a specific messenger RNA codon during protein synthesis.

mRNA

Messenger RNA, a form of RNA that transfers genetic instructions from DNA to the ribosome for protein synthesis.
